Quarter-finals of Basketball Ireland National Cup to take place this weekend

THE QUARTER-FINALS of the Basketball Ireland National Cup takes place this weekend, with three Limerick teams in action. 

In the President's mens National Cup both Limerick Sport Eagles and Limerick Celtics will be hoping to book a spot in the semi-finals.

Limerick Sport Eagles received a bye in the first round of the cup and now face SETU Carlow in the quarter-finals this Sunday in Carlow at 1:00pm. 

SETU Carlow had an impressive first round win against Scotts Lakers Killarney and will be extremely tough to beat on their home court. 

Limerick Celtics men's team beat SETU Waterford in the first round of the President's cup on a scoreline of 101-93 and will play Moy Tolka Rovers in the Carroll Arena in Dublin on Saturday at 8:15pm. 

In the women's division one National Cup, Limerick Celtics will compete against Templeogue at home on Sunday at 4:15pm. 

Celtics beat local rivals Limerick Sport Huskies in the opening round of the cup 94-88.
